ThermalHEART® Range Overview Chart ThermalHEART® core design principles
Variable platform design
Compatibility
Sharing benefits
Variable platform design allows 44mm and 56mm platforms by simply using a different thermal strip. This provides common aesthetics, assembly processes, punching and machining details.
Internal profiles like sashes, panels and mullions are shared across the updated ThermalHEART® ranges to provide a mix-and-match ability while keeping aesthetics and sightlines aligned.
Consistant platform details combined with shared internal profiles across the ThermalHEART® ranges facilitates reduced component stock requirements, machining details, assembly details and punch tooling. Sharing across product ranges ultimately enables significant factory efficiencies.
